Materials courses can help you learn about the properties of metals, polymers, ceramics, and composites, as well as techniques for testing and analyzing these materials. You can build skills in material selection, failure analysis, and sustainability practices in material usage. Many courses introduce tools like CAD software for design, finite element analysis for stress testing, and various laboratory techniques for material characterization, allowing you to apply your knowledge in practical settings.
